Hell earn a $5,000 bonus for any academic year in which the teams Academic Progress Rate (APR) is between 985-989. Veteran men's hockey coach Jerry York - who has won five NCAA titles . When Boston University released its report Wednesday on hockey players culture of sexual entitlement, it kept most of the investigation details including accounts of sexual debauchery and wide-ranging allegations of academic trouble confined to confidential subcommittee reports.
